What the Comparison Sites Won't Tell You
The remortgage window is a free option too few people use. Most lenders let you lock a deal half a year ahead — if rates rise you're protected, and many lenders let you switch to a cheaper deal before it starts.
Watch the fee, not just the rate. A £1,499 arrangement fee on a lower rate only pays off above a certain loan size — roughly £150,000+ for typical gaps. Run both totals over the fixed period before deciding.

Getting a Mortgage in Bournemouth
The mortgage process in Bournemouth is the same as anywhere in England/Wales/Scotland. You'll need to:
- Check your credit score at Experian or CheckMyFile
- Get an Agreement in Principle (AIP) from a lender
- Find a property and make an offer
- Submit your full mortgage application
- Receive your mortgage offer and complete

Bad Credit Mortgages in Bournemouth
Have a CCJ, IVA, or missed payments? Specialist lenders including Precise Mortgages, Aldermore, and Pepper Money offer bad credit mortgages across Bournemouth and the UK. You'll likely need a larger deposit (15–25%).

Almost all fixed deals allow 10% overpayment per year without penalty. Overpaying early in the term saves the most interest.
The majority of lenders require at least 5–10% of the property price. Rates improve sharply once you pass 15–20% — the biggest pricing jumps happen at 90%, 85% and 75% loan-to-value.
Expect roughly £2,000–£4,000 covering valuation, legal work, searches and any lender arrangement fee. First-time buyers get stamp duty relief on lower-priced homes.
A decision in principle usually uses a soft check, which leaves no mark on your score. The full application is a hard check — which is why you should pick your lender before applying, not after.
Lenders cap borrowing at 4.5x income for most applicants. Some banks stretch to 5.5x for qualifying professions or joint incomes over £60,000.
